The Mechanics of Earning Sats
At its core, a Satoshi (Sat) is the smallest unit of Bitcoin, equivalent to one hundred-millionth of a BTC. Earning Sats through decentralized social apps on BTC L2 leverages the Lightning Network's capabilities, allowing for near-instantaneous and low-cost transactions. These apps, built on BTC L2, enable users to engage in peer-to-peer interactions without the need to clog the main blockchain.
Consider a social media app built on the Lightning Network. Users can follow, like, share, and comment without worrying about transaction fees or slow processing times. When you engage with content, the app utilizes off-chain transactions processed by the Lightning Network, making the experience smooth and cost-effective. This innovation not only enhances user experience but also scales Bitcoin to accommodate a broader audience.

The Lightning Network: Enabling Seamless Transactions
The Lightning Network, often hailed as Bitcoin’s internet of value, is pivotal in enabling decentralized social apps to offer seamless transactions. By creating a network of payment channels, the Lightning Network allows users to make an infinite number of micropayments without clogging the main blockchain.
For instance, in a decentralized social app, if you create engaging content or offer a service, users can instantly tip you in Sats through the Lightning Network. This process is incredibly fast and economical, making it feasible to earn small amounts continuously. The efficiency of the Lightning Network ensures that every transaction is processed almost instantaneously, providing a frictionless experience.
Benefits of Earning Sats on BTC L2
Scalability: One of the most significant benefits of earning Sats on BTC L2 is scalability. The Lightning Network addresses the throughput limitations of Bitcoin’s main blockchain, allowing for millions of transactions per second. This scalability ensures that decentralized social apps can grow and handle increased user engagement without performance degradation.
Cost Efficiency: Traditional transactions on the Bitcoin mainnet can incur high fees, especially during periods of network congestion. In contrast, transactions on the Lightning Network are almost free, making it economically viable for users to earn and spend Sats continuously.
Speed: The speed of transactions on the Lightning Network is unparalleled. What would take minutes or even hours on the main blockchain happens in milliseconds on the Lightning Network, providing an ultra-fast experience for users.
